Correctionville and Sioux City are places in Iowa.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.
Sioux City has the higher population (85,651 vs 768 in Correctionville). Sioux City has the higher median household income ($65,473 vs $51,125 in Correctionville). Sioux City has the higher median home value ($162,600 vs $83,000 in Correctionville).
Population, income & housing
| Correctionville | Sioux City | |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 768 | 85,651 |
| Median age | 35.5 yrs | 35.4 yrs |
| Median household income | $51,125 | $65,473 |
| Median home value | $83,000 | $162,600 |
| Median gross rent | $775 | $936 |
| Housing units | 336 | 34,901 |
| Homeownership rate | 89.4% | 65.5% |
| Bachelor's degree or higher | 12.6% | 21.7% |
| Unemployment rate | 2.3% | 4.5% |
Trends (ACS 5-year, 2019–2023)
| Correctionville | Sioux City | |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 807 → 768 (-4.8%) | 82,531 → 85,651 (+3.8%) |
| Median household income | $44,500 → $51,125 (+14.9%) | $55,433 → $65,473 (+18.1%) |
| Median home value | $68,800 → $83,000 (+20.6%) | $116,600 → $162,600 (+39.5%) |
| Median gross rent | $538 → $775 (+44.1%) | $783 → $936 (+19.5%) |

Age & race/ethnicity
Age distribution (share)
| Correctionville | Sioux City | |
|---|---|---|
| Under 5 | 8.5% | 7.0% |
| 5 to 17 | 25.7% | 19.1% |
| 18 to 24 | 2.7% | 11.2% |
| 25 to 34 | 12.9% | 12.3% |
| 35 to 44 | 5.7% | 12.6% |
| 45 to 54 | 6.9% | 12.0% |
| 55 to 64 | 13.5% | 11.2% |
| 65 to 74 | 10.5% | 8.9% |
| 75 and over | 13.5% | 5.8% |
Race & ethnicity (share)
| Correctionville | Sioux City | |
|---|---|---|
| White (non-Hispanic) | 77.2% | 63.3% |
| Black or African American | 0.8% | 5.4% |
| American Indian & Alaska Native | 0.0% | 1.5% |
| Asian | 0.3% | 2.8% |
| Native Hawaiian & Pacific Islander | 0.0% | 0.5% |
| Some other race | 0.3% | 0.2% |
| Two or more races | 0.5% | 4.4% |
| Hispanic or Latino | 21.0% | 21.9% |
Educational attainment (age 25+)
Share of adults 25+
| Correctionville | Sioux City | |
|---|---|---|
| No high school diploma | 15.1% | 15.1% |
| High school graduate | 45.8% | 32.7% |
| Some college or associate's | 26.6% | 30.5% |
| Bachelor's degree | 9.9% | 14.3% |
| Graduate or professional degree | 2.7% | 7.4% |
Commute to work
How workers get to work (share)
| Correctionville | Sioux City | |
|---|---|---|
| Drove alone | 74.6% | 79.9% |
| Carpooled | 14.7% | 11.5% |
| Public transit | 0.8% | 1.4% |
| Walked | 1.2% | 2.0% |
| Bicycle | 0.0% | 0.1% |
| Worked from home | 8.7% | 4.6% |
| Other means | 0.0% | 0.6% |
Housing
Units in structure (share)
| Correctionville | Sioux City | |
|---|---|---|
| 1-unit, detached | 89.9% | 71.2% |
| 1-unit, attached | 0.0% | 3.0% |
| 2 to 4 units | 3.3% | 6.4% |
| 5 to 19 units | 2.4% | 7.2% |
| 20 or more units | 0.6% | 8.6% |
| Mobile home & other | 3.9% | 3.6% |
Poverty & households
| Correctionville | Sioux City | |
|---|---|---|
| Poverty rate | 14.8% | 14.6% |
| Average household size | 2.52 | 2.53 |
| Mean commute (minutes) | 32 | 17 |
| Median year structure built | 1948 | 1956 |
